WebAug 5, 2024 · Hunting not only directly helps wildlife by controlling population numbers, but it also indirectly helps through the funding of different conservation efforts. When you purchase something such as a hunting license or a tag, you’re giving money to your state’s game and fish departments. greenpoint loft wedding cost

Now some experts are calling for a program to regulate Africa's... WebHunting is an important management tool. For many wildlife species, hunting helps to maintain populations at levels compatible with human activity, land use, and available habitat.
